Nicholas Latifi ‘super-excited' to finally receive Williams upgrades

A 'super-excited' Nicholas Latifi will finally receive the upgrades that will see his FW44 be on equal-terms with team-mate Alex Albon at this weekend's French Grand Prix. The Canadian driver has had to wait two races to have the upgrades fitted to his car, with Albon having received the package at the British Grand Prix. It comes at a time when Latifi is desperate for good results, with his career in Formula 1 barely hanging by a thread. It's highly expected that Latifi will be dropped by Williams Racing at the end of the season, and potentially replaced by Alpine F1 Team reserve driver Oscar Piastri.
